Stan Lee will continue his now lengthy run of cameos in the upcoming Captain America: Civil War, and while brief, his time on screen will mean a great deal.

In an interview with Nova 96.9, Co-Director Joe Russo spoke a bit about the process of crafting a Lee cameo as they go along, saying "and then, you know, as we work through the script, we look for a great cameo for Stan as we're writing you know, and that's our interaction with Stan."
Elaborating further on his cameo in Civil War, Russo made it clear that his part does contain some relevance to the overall plot. He was also asked if it was hard to integrate him in a way he hasn't before in other films.
"I think so, you're always looking to keep it different with him and you want to surprise the audience because they get a kick out of it, but you also want to make it relevant in some way, so he delivers a key piece of information in the movie."
Captain America: Civil War opens on May 6th.
